In STATA clustered standard errors are obtained by adding the option cluster (variable_name) to your regression, where variable_name specifies the variable that defines the group / cluster in your data. Using the ,vce (cluster [cluster variable] command negates the need for independent observations, requiring only that from cluster to cluster the observations are independent. With panel data it's generally wise to cluster on the dimension of the individual effect as both heteroskedasticity and autocorrellation are almost certain to exist in the residuals at the individual level. 8. In practice, people will often cluster at progressively higher levels and stop clustering when there is relatively little change in the standard errors. To be conservative and avoid bias, use bigger and more aggregate clusters when possible, up to and including the point at which there is concern about having too few clusters.
